اورت چیست?

UART مخفف گیرنده/فرستنده ناهمزمان جهانی است. این یک رابط/پروتکل ارتباطی سریال مانند SPI و I2C است, این می تواند یک مدار فیزیکی در میکروکنترلر باشد, یا یک IC مستقل. هدف اصلی UART انتقال و دریافت داده های سریال است. یکی از بهترین چیزها در مورد ماژول های بلوتوث UART این است که فقط از دو سیم برای انتقال داده ها بین دستگاه ها استفاده می کند.

UARTS داده ها را به صورت غیر همزمان منتقل می کند, این بدان معنی است که هیچ سیگنال ساعت برای همگام سازی خروجی بیت ها از UART انتقال دهنده به نمونه گیری بیت ها توسط دریافت کننده UART وجود ندارد. به جای سیگنال ساعت, Transming UART بیت های شروع و متوقف شده را به بسته داده منتقل می کند. این بیت ها شروع و پایان بسته داده را تعریف می کنند تا دریافت کننده UART بداند چه موقع شروع به خواندن بیت ها می کند.

هنگامی که UART دریافت کننده یک شروع را تشخیص می دهد, شروع به خواندن بیت های ورودی با فرکانس خاص معروف به نرخ Baud می کند. نرخ Baud اندازه گیری سرعت انتقال داده است, بیان شده در بیت در ثانیه (BPS). هر دو UART باید تقریباً با همان نرخ Baud کار کنند. نرخ Baud بین انتقال و دریافت UART فقط قبل از اینکه زمان بیت ها خیلی زیاد شود ، می تواند حدود 5 ± متفاوت باشد.

1650013400 1

چه پین ​​هایی در UART وجود دارد?

VCC: پین منبع تغذیه, معمولاً 3.3 ولت

GND: سنجاق

RX: پین داده را دریافت کنید

TX: انتقال پین داده

در حال حاضر, محبوب ترین HCI اتصال UART و USB است, UART به طور کلی محبوب تر است زیرا سطح عملکرد و سطح عملکرد آن با رابط های USB قابل مقایسه است, و پروتکل انتقال نسبتاً ساده است, که باعث کاهش سربار نرم افزار می شود و یک راه حل سخت افزاری کامل مقرون به صرفه تر است.

رابط UART می تواند با یک ماژول بلوتوث خارج از قفسه کار کند.

همه Feasycom's ماژول های بلوتوث از رابط UART به طور پیش فرض پشتیبانی کنید. ما همچنین صفحه بندر سریال TTL را برای ارتباطات UART تهیه می کنیم. برای توسعه دهندگان محصولات خود بسیار راحت و آسان است.

برای جزئیات ماژول های بلوتوث ارتباطات UART, شما می توانید مستقیماً با تیم فروش Feasycom تماس بگیرید.